Socialization

Macaws are extremely social birds, and they are accustomed to living in large groups in the wild. They also enjoy socializing and play with humans. If not properly socialized the macaw may become fearful and may exhibit negative behaviors, such as feather-picking or aggression. Socialization can be started early and the bird gradually introduced to other animals and people. This can be accomplished through snacks, food, toys and an exercise gym. It will help build trust by stepping out of the cage each day to play with your macaw.

If you're planning to acquire macaws, you should think about the time commitment needed to care for it. To be content the large birds require constant attention, interaction and stimulation of the mind. They must be exposed to a variety of experiences including visits to veterinarians for avian species and other pets or family members, visiting and even car rides to overcome their fear of flying and to learn that these experiences are enjoyable and safe.

Training

Macaws require a lot mental stimulation. They are able to form an unrivalled relationship with their owners and enjoy a long life span. To maximize their potential, it's crucial to begin training them early in their lives. A well-trained macaw is more likely to respond to commands and learn new behaviors quickly. The best method to train a macaw is to use positive reinforcement. This means rewarding your macaw with treats or attention whenever it displays the behavior you desire. It is also essential to provide lots of toys and enrichment items for your macaw. These could be as basic as chunks of wood for the bird to chew on a regular basis, or as elaborate as an indoor play center designed to test the bird's instincts.

Macaws require a lot of mental stimulation. They are intelligent birds. If they're not entertained they can resort to destructive or noisy behavior. They may also begin to pick at their feathers to indicate that they are stressed and bored. Providing plenty of toys and games to keep your bird entertained is a good way to prevent this from happening.

Apart from food, you'll need to purchase toys and other cleaning items for your macaw. You can cut down on these monthly costs by buying items in bulk when possible. For example, buying large packages of cleaning supplies and liners will cost less than purchasing smaller packages. Also, try to stay clear of items that could be harmful to birds, like nonstick baking dishes, household cleaners with strong odors, and air fresheners containing fragrances.
